what is earned income - Next comes the outdoor unit installation. This is where the actual AC unit is placed, usually on a concrete pad or a sturdy platform. The technician will make sure it's level and secure and that there's enough space around it for proper airflow. This part usually involves the unit being placed in an area that is out of sight. Keep in mind that a good installer will know the best spot for the unit to be placed. The placement is critical for the unit's performance and longevity. After that, they will connect the refrigerant lines, which carry the coolant between the indoor and outdoor units. It's super important these connections are sealed tightly to prevent leaks.

Alright, first things first: let's get down to the nitty-gritty of the Netherlands' geographical location. The Netherlands is situated in Northwestern Europe, along the North Sea. It's a low-lying country, with a significant portion of its land reclaimed from the sea – talk about innovative! Its precise coordinates place it roughly between 51° and 54° north latitude and 3° and 7° east longitude. This strategic location has historically made the Netherlands a hub for trade, culture, and innovation. The country's position provides easy access to major European markets, making it a prime spot for international business. Its coastal location also means it has a long history what is earned income of maritime activities, including fishing, shipping, and shipbuilding. So, when you're thinking about the Netherlands, picture a country that's not just on the map, but strategically placed to connect people and ideas. This positioning has played a crucial role in its historical significance and economic prosperity, making it a key player in the European landscape. The country's unique geographical features, like its polders (land reclaimed from the sea), also contribute to its distinct identity. These features showcase the Dutch people's relentless efforts to shape their environment, creating a vibrant and resilient society. Its location, combined with its innovative spirit, has made the Netherlands a truly remarkable nation.

Okay, first things first: **what exactly is a recession?** A recession is a significant decline in economic activity spread across the economy, lasting more than a few months, normally visible in real GDP, real income, employment, industrial production, and wholesale-retail sales. Recessions are a normal part of the business cycle, but they can be scary because they often lead to job losses, reduced consumer spending, and overall economic uncertainty.
